OnPointerDown is not called when clicking a UI element, if the angle between the canvas and the camera is bigger than 90 degrees
Reproduction steps:
1. Open the attached project "case_677438-Errors 2"
2. Open the scene "Test" and play
3. Press "Position 1" button, the camera will be pointed away from the canvas
4. Click on the red image, OnPointerDown will not be called
5. Press "Position 2" button, the camera will be pointed towards the canvas
6. Click on the red image. A message will be logged to the console, indicating that OnPointerDown was called
